When Dallas, an 8-year-old white Labrador, vanished from his home near the Coweta County Fairgrounds on Aug. 27, Katherine Kuring thought she would have him back within hours.

Nearly two months later, she is still searching and now fears someone may have taken him.

“I’ve never lost a dog before,” Kuring said. “We have 27 acres, and they know the property like the back of their paw. If Dallas could have come home, he would have.”

That morning, Kuring was caring for her horses while her husband was traveling. When she realized her two dogs were missing, she checked their GPS collars, but for the first time ever, the trackers were offline despite being fully charged.
